We are recruiting for an Industrial Electrical Engineer to join a busy manufacturing site. This is a hands-on role focused on maintaining production equipment, responding to breakdowns, completing planned maintenance and improving machine reliability.
The Role:
- Carry out planned, preventative and reactive electrical maintenance
- Fault find and repair production machinery to minimise downtime
- Respond to breakdowns and identify root causes of faults
- Support machine set-up, calibration and production changeovers
- Maintain accurate maintenance records
- Work closely with production and engineering teams
- Support mechanical tasks where required and develop multi-skilled capability
- Ensure all work is completed safely and in line with site procedures
About You:
- Electrical engineering or maintenance background within manufacturing or industrial environments
- Strong electrical fault-finding skills
- Experience working on production machinery
- Knowledge of electrical regulations and safe isolation
- 18th Edition Wiring Regulations preferred
- Inspection & Testing experience advantageous
